Appendix B. Safety Climate Questionnaire (SCQ)—Short Version
No. | question | replies: |
SA – strongly agree | ||
A – agree | ||
NANDA – neither agree nor disagree | ||
DA – disagree | ||
SDA – strongly disagree | ||
1. | The machines and devices I operate undergo interim check-ups. | SA A NANDA DA SDA |
2. | I have been involved in the occupational risk assessment process at my workstation. | SA A NANDA DA SDA |
3. | The employer’s actions linked to occupational safety are consulted with employees. | SA A NANDA DA SDA |
4. | From time to time, I happen to perform my duties not in compliance with the rules of occupational safety and health. | SA A NANDA DA SDA |
5. | Employees can test personal protection equipment (e.g., footwear, goggles and glasses) prior to the decision to purchase them. | SA A NANDA DA SDA |
6. | In our firm employees are members of the teams working to improve safety within the organisation (e.g., they participate in formulating safety procedures, OHS instructions, in the works of post-accident teams, risk assessment, OSH committee). | SA A NANDA DA SDA |
7. | My workstation is orderly and tidy (tools are kept in the same place and waste is removed on a current basis) and it is important for me to keep the workstation tidy. | SA A NANDA DA SDA |
8. | Employees are advised of any implementation of long-term safety projects (e.g., ISO, OHSAS, prophylactic programmes, behaviours at the workstation monitoring programme). | SA A NANDA DA SDA |
9. | My employer takes measures to improve safety within the organisation. | SA A NANDA DA SDA |
10. | My superiors are not interested in OSH issues. | SA A NANDA DA SDA |
11. | From time to time my superior happens to assign a task to be fulfilled contrary to the rules of occupational safety (e.g., to remove the protective shield from the machine so that it works faster). | SA A NANDA DA SDA |
12. | My superior intervenes whenever the work safety rules are being breached. | SA A NANDA DA SDA |
13. | I disregard my superior’s remarks and instructions on safety (e.g., I do not wear protective gloves, footwear, hearing protectors, even though my superior has admonished me to wear them). | SA A NANDA DA SDA |
14. | From time to time, I happen to behave riskily (e.g., I remove protective shields from machines, carry out minor repairs while the machine is in operation, exceed the allowable speed, take shortcuts to hit the target more quickly). | SA A NANDA DA SDA |
15. | The plant has an ‘accidents at work’ information system (e.g., a mannequin with locations of injuries, information board, newsletter). | SA A NANDA DA SDA |
16. | In my firm, safe work performance by employees is promoted (e.g., by being taken into account in the employee assessment process). | SA A NANDA DA SDA |
17. | From time to time, my superior happens not to follow the safety rules. | SA A NANDA DA SDA |
18. | The number of tasks I have to perform on a daily basis causes me to have to work at a very fast pace. | SA A NANDA DA SDA |
19. | My superior gives me feedback on my work performance, bringing attention to the fact that I must work safely. | SA A NANDA DA SDA |
20. | My superior’s conduct sets an example for me in terms of safety. | SA A NANDA DA SDA |
21. | My superiors actively participate in safety promotion actions organised by the firm. | SA A NANDA DA SDA |
22. | Each and every accident that has happened in our plant is discussed by the superior during information meetings. | SA A NANDA DA SDA |
23. | The plant maintains a logbook of potentially dangerous incidents (near-accidents). | SA A NANDA DA SDA |
24. | The logbook of potentially dangerous incidents (near-accidents) is used, for example, to advise employees of the risks and prophylactic measures taken. | SA A NANDA DA SDA |
25. | My superiors ‘turn a blind eye’ on how work is performed—no matter whether or not it is done safely. What matters is timeliness and the required output. | SA A NANDA DA SDA |
26. | Particularly dangerous places are adequately marked. | SA A NANDA DA SDA |
27. | I usually work under time pressure. | SA A NANDA DA SDA |
28. | Our organisation has an action plan to improve occupational safety. | SA A NANDA DA SDA |
29. | The work I do is very strenuous for me. | SA A NANDA DA SDA |
30. | My daily work schedule changes very often. | SA A NANDA DA SDA |
31. | I feel that my superior motivates me to work safely. | SA A NANDA DA SDA |
32. | After the entire day of work, I suffer from various muscular/backbone ailments (e.g., corns, backbone pains). | SA A NANDA DA SDA |
33. | The rules of moving around the plant are clearly specified. | SA A NANDA DA SDA |
34. | Machines and devices are repaired by qualified teams. | SA A NANDA DA SDA |
35. | Control elements of machines are well visible and marked. | SA A NANDA DA SDA |
36. | I have been advised of the occupational risk assessment at my workstation. | SA A NANDA DA SDA |
37. | I have a good relationship with my superior and I know I can rely on him/her in case of an emergency. | SA A NANDA DA SDA |
38. | When doing a dangerous job, I know I can trust my colleagues with whom I am fulfilling a dangerous task. | SA A NANDA DA SDA |
39. | I feel well-informed about protection against my occupational risks. | SA A NANDA DA SDA |
40. | I believe I am well-trained in providing first aid and if an accident were to happen, I would know what to do. | SA A NANDA DA SDA |
41. | I know the employee and the employer’s duties in respect of safety. | SA A NANDA DA SDA |
42. | Upon change of my workstation—prior to starting work at a new workstation I am given the workstation instruction. | SA A NANDA DA SDA |
43. | I have a good relationship with my colleagues in the workplace. | SA A NANDA DA SDA |
44. | In our organisation safety is a priority, the process of improving safety is continuous. | SA A NANDA DA SDA |
45. | Communication within the team is difficult, there is no knowing who you can trust. | SA A NANDA DA SDA |
46. | Our organisation continuously takes various measures to improve work safety. | SA A NANDA DA SDA |
47. | In our organisation, safety issues are only discussed when an accident or inspection takes place. | SA A NANDA DA SDA |
48. | Our firm conducts practical exercises (e.g., evacuation exercise, accident simulation). | SA A NANDA DA SDA |
49. | When working in a team, I know I can trust the other team members. | SA A NANDA DA SDA |
50. | When doing work I know very well, I happen to flout the OSH rules from time to time. | SA A NANDA DA SDA |
